Summary: | Within the ESiWACE-2 service on porting applications to pre-exascale machines, we have collaborated with theFESOM-2 team to accelerate parts of their model on GPU's.FESOM-2 is a finite-volume ocean and sea-ice model based on unstructured meshes. We have used the OpenACC programming model to speed up the transport of tracers inFESOM-2. In this talk, I will share the results of this effort, describe our collaboration with theFESOMteam and present some technical aspects of the implementation. Finally, I will iterate on the lessons learned and the road ahead forFESOM-2 towards exascale.
